At approximately 12:30 pm on Tuesday, 24 January 2017, Israeli Occupation Forces (IOF) arrested Nasha’t Mohammed Abu Rouk, 36, a resident of Khuza’a village eastern Khan Younis.
According to Al Mezan’s field investigations, on 9 June 2016, Nasha’t Abu Rouk went to visit his sick father who is currently lives in Toulkarem. Nasha’t was arrested while he was on his way to Rmallah. He is arrested at Nafha prison.
